I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S  1)  Read these instructions.  2)  Keep these instructions.  3)  Heed all warnings.  4)  Follow all instructions.  5)  Do not use this apparatus near water.  6)  Clean only with dry cloth. 7)  Do not block any ventilation openings. Install in accordance with the manufacturer’s instructions.  8)  Do not install near any heat sources such as radiators, heat registers, stoves, or other apparatus (including amplifiers) that produce heat.  9)  Do not defeat the safety purpose of the polarized or grounding-type plug. A polarized plug has two blades with one wider than the other. A grounding-type plug has two blades and a third grounding prong. The wide blade or the third prong are provided for your safety. If the provided plug does not fit into your outlet, consult an electrician for replacement of the obsolete outlet.10)  Protect the power cord from being walked on or pinched particularly at plugs, convenience receptacles, and the point where they exit from the apparatus.11)  Only use attachments/accessories specified by the manufacturer.12)  Use only with the cart, stand, tripod, bracket, or table specified by the manufacturer, or sold with the apparatus. When a cart is used, use caution when moving the cart/apparatus combination to avoid injury from tip-over.13)  Unplug this apparatus during lightning storms or when unused for long periods of time.14)  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el. Servicing is required when the apparatus has been damaged in any way, such as a power-supply cord or plug is damaged, liquid has been spilled or objects have fallen into the apparatus, the apparatus has been exposed to rain or moisture, does not operate normally, or has been dropped.Power Source WarningA label on this product indicates the correct power source for this product. Operate this product only from an electrical outlet with the voltage and frequency indicated on the product label. If you are uncertain of the type of power supply to your home or business, consult your service provider or your local power company.The AC inlet on the unit must remain accessible and operable at all times.Notice to InstallersThe servicing instructions in this notice are for use by quali ed service personnel only. No user-serviceable parts inside. Refer servicing to qualified service personnel.Ground the ProductWARNING: Avoid electric shock and  re hazard! If this product connects to coaxial cable wiring, be sure the cable system is grounded (earthed). Grounding provides some protection against voltage surges and built-up static charges.WARNING: Avoid electric shock and  re hazard! Do not locate an outside antenna system in the vicinity of overhead power lines or power circuits. Touching power lines or circuits might be fatal. This product may contain a tuner capable of receiving o -the-air broadcasts.Protect the Product from LightningIn addition to disconnecting the AC power from the wall outlet, disconnect the signal inputs.Verify the Power Source from the On/O  Power LightWhen the on/o  power light is not illuminated, the apparatus may still be connected to the power source. The light may go out when the apparatus is turned o , regardless of whether it is still plugged into an AC power source. Eliminate AC Power/Mains OverloadsWARNING: Avoid electric shock and  re hazard! Do not overload AC power/mains, outlets, extension cords,or integral convenience receptacles. For products that require battery power or other power sources to operate them, refer to the operating instructions for those products.Provide Ventilation and Select a Location•  Remove all packaging material before applying power to the product. •  Do not place this apparatus on a bed, sofa, rug, or similar surface.•  Do not place this apparatus on an unstable surface.•  Do not install this apparatus in an enclosure, such as a bookcase    or rack, unless the installation provides proper ventilation.•  Do not place entertainment devices (such as VCRs or DVDs), lamps,   books, vases with liquids, or other objects on top of this product.•  Do not block ventilation openings.Operating EnvironmentThis product is designed for operation indoors with a temperature range from 32° to 104° F (0° to 40°C). Each product should have adequate spacing on all sides so that the cooling air vents on the chassis are not blocked.Protect from Exposure to Moisture and Foreign ObjectsWARNING: Avoid electric shock and  re hazard! Do not expose this product to dripping or splashing liquids, rain, or moisture. Objects  lled with liquids, such as vases, should not be placed on this apparatus.WARNING: Avoid electric shock and  re hazard! Unplug this product before cleaning. Do not use a liquid cleaner or an aerosol cleaner. Do not use a magnetic/static cleaning device (dust remover) to clean this product.WARNING: Avoid electric shock and  re hazard! Never push objects through the openings in this product. Foreign objects can cause electrical shorts that can result in electric shock or  re.
